It mostly worked fine for me except when I zipped a .zip file containing a .exe file. 
This was allowed through.
Either recursive searching of .zip within .zip files or a BANZIPinZIP option would be 
an interesting option.

Certainly a big improvement over two days ago. You've made zip files safe again.

FYI, we now have a new interim release 1.78i7 (at 
http://www.declude.com/interim ) that will allow you to ban file extensions 
within .ZIP files.

To do this, you can add either the line "BANZIPEXTS ON" to the 
\IMail\Declude\virus.cfg file (to ban file extensions within .ZIP files, 
for files that are not encrypted) and/or "BANEZIPEXTS ON" (to ban file 
extensions within .ZIP files, for files that are encrypted).  They will use 
the same file extensions as the BANEXT option.

So if you already have "BANEXT exe" in the \IMail\Declude\virus.cfg file, 
and add lines "BANZIPEXTS ON" and "BANEZIPEXTS ON" to the virus.cfg file, 
Declude Virus will block both standard .exe files as well as .exe files 
within .ZIP files (whether or not they are encrypted).
